Please note that U.S. Federal law forbids the carnage of hazardous materials aboard aircraft in your luggage or on your person. A violation can result in five years' imprisonment and penalties of 5250.000 or more (49 U.S.C. 5124). Hazardous materials include explosives. compressed gases. flammable liquids and solids, oxidizers. poisons. corrosives and radioactive materials. Examples: Paints. lighter fluid. fireworks. tear gases, oxygen bottles. and radio-pharmaceuticals. There are special exceptions for small quantities (up to 70 ounces total) of medicinal and toilet articles carried in you' luggage and certain smoking materials carried on your person. CAI IF ORNIA• This transaction is covered by the California Travel Consumer Restitution Fund (TCRF) if the seller of travel was registered and participating in the TCRF at the time of sale and the passenger is located ki California at the time of payment. Eligible passengers may file a daim with TCRF if the passenger is owed a refund of more than S50 for transportation or travel services which the seller of travel failed to fa-ward to a proper provider a such money was not refunded to you when required. The maxi-num amount which may be paid by the TCRF to any one passenger is the total amount paid on behalf of the passenger to the seller of travel. not to exceed 515.000. A claim must be submitted to the TCRF within 12 months after the scheduled completion date of the travel. A claim must include sufficient documentation to prove your dam and a $35 processng fee. CAaimants must agree to waive their right to other civil remedies against a registered participating seller of travel for matters arising out of a sale for which you file a TCRF claim. You may request a claim form by writing to: Travel Consumer Restitution Corporation: P.O. Box 6001: Larkspur. CA 94977-6001: a by visiting TCRC's website at: www.tcrenfo.org.
